Transaction 81a2a8f17451e947601538de8d02a757aea05792ad15996e37ffe892185a7f97
1 Input
1 Output
-
81a2a8f17451e947601538de8d02a757aea05792ad15996e37ffe892185a7f97:0
- value
- 349954
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9d3430b64bfbb78e7d9ea43d8995b29d14a459ab OP_EQUAL
- address
- 3G2EXuUFdxX5dTqeve4qhRAXrn4StHhaJY